Shares of McDonald's Corp. $(MCD)$ slipped 1.63% to $268.10 Tuesday, on what proved to be an all-around positive trading session for the stock market, with the S&P 500 Index rising 0.32% to 7,677.28 and the Dow Jones Industrial Average rising 0.30% to 53,577.40.
The stock's fall snapped a five-day winning streak.
McDonald's Corp. closed 21.55% below its 52-week high of $341.75, which the company achieved on March 2nd.
The stock underperformed when compared to some of its competitors Tuesday, as Starbucks Corp. $(SBUX)$ fell 1.61% to $105.76, Chipotle Mexican Grill Inc. $(CMG)$ fell 1.55% to $37.43, and Yum! Brands Inc. $(YUM)$ fell 0.69% to $156.27.
Trading volume (3.2 M) remained 1.4 million below its 50-day average volume of 4.6 M.
